Advanced virtual fencing and control system for animals

Project Abstract / Summary :
Animal Husbandry has become an important source of income for millions of rural families and has taken an important role in providing employment and income generating opportunity. Indian Dairying shows few of the best Statistics. Today, India has the world's largest dairy herd, and is second only to the United States in milk production. Managing this immense number of animals is not an easy task. Often herds of cattle cross boundaries, lose direction and encroach into restricted areas. Also overgrazing is causing a serious problem of soil erosion. Construction of a real physical fence is too expensive and due to large and variable areas of grass lands, it is difficult too. In order to overcome these shortcomings of traditional ways, we design a Virtual Fence in order to control and manage animals. Virtual fencing is a method of controlling animals without ground-based fencing. Control occurs by altering an animal’s behaviour through one or more sensory cues administered to the animal after it has attempted to penetrate an electronically-generated boundary. This boundary can be of any geometrical shape, and though unseen by the eye, is detected by a computer system worn by the animal. This is done using injection control system.​

Why did you choose to work on this project topic : Intensive labour activity is involved in herding. Animals graze over large areas of pastures separated by fences. Often they are shifted to other pastures in order to avoid overgrazing at one location. This activity requires a lot of man power so there is a need for a revolution using technology, communication and automation. Large sums of money and time is spent by farmers on maintenance and building of these fences.
Harsh climatic conditions also pose a problem for herding.

Project Highlights : Animals are rotated among paddocks in an attempt to prevent overgrazing, and for husbandry practices such as during calving or weaning. Fence technology has changed from stone and hedge to electrified wires, but is still labour intensive to install and maintain and is not easily reconfigured.so our proposed system overcomes these limitations.
